I built Unjam — a tool to stop the mental spiral when you’re overwhelmed

One thing I’ve noticed about stress is that it’s rarely about the amount of work.

It’s usually about the mental spiral that happens before you even start.

You know the feeling:

You sit down to work or study and your brain starts going:

• “What if I fail?”
• “What if I’m already behind?”
• “What if I’m not good enough?”

Suddenly you’re not even thinking about the task anymore — you’re stuck in a loop.

I built a small tool called Unjam to help interrupt that spiral.

The idea is simple:

You write what’s bothering you, and the system tries to:
• identify the core issue
• explain why it feels overwhelming
• suggest one clear next step

It doesn’t give answers or motivational speeches.

The goal is just to untangle your thoughts enough so you can think clearly again.

Still improving the responses so they feel less generic and more specific.
